Transaction ffda6914f4597c33f163206a7e71dc9228427da64d9b7364e6156d55679fb401
1 Input
1 Output
-
ffda6914f4597c33f163206a7e71dc9228427da64d9b7364e6156d55679fb401:0
- value
- 15780
- script pubkey
- OP_0 OP_PUSHBYTES_32 ef5beddb779af411ea63437ec24fd42cc2cf8b93a4b0c294443d9be2d43cc03a
- address
- bc1qaad7mkmhnt6pr6nrgdlvyn759npvlzun5jcv99zy8kd794pucqaqp6eqc0